Experiment on the injection beam kicker magnets
Description
Models of injection beam kicker magnet system have been constructed and tested for the filling cycle of 10 minutes at 360 pps with a norminal current of a few kiloampere. Based upon the experimental results, the power supply for the system could be specified. The original designed modulator circuit was found to be quite adequate for operation but subjected to some modifications. 13 figs., 2 tabs
